JOB DESCRIPTION SUMMARY

The occupational therapist contracted through the Organization is responsible for the implementation of standards of care for occupational therapy services and for adherence to all conditions outlined in the Service Agreement.


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S/RESPONSIBILITIES

  1. Evaluates patient’s functional status (muscle function, endurance, visual coordination, written and verbal communication skills, self care ability, work capacity, etc.). Evaluates home environment for hazards or barriers to more independent living. Identifies equipment

needs. Participates in the development of the total plan of care.

  1. For patients who plan to return to work, the occupational therapist may perform work capacity evaluation and may refer to specialized vocational training in accordance with Organization
  2. Develops treatment program and establishes goals for improved Communicates plan of care to referring physician and other Organization professionals.
  3. May teach new skills or retrain patient in once familiar daily activities that have been lost due to illness or injury, in accordance with Organization policy.
  4. May fabricate splints and instruct patient in the use of various types of adaptive equipment to improve function.
  5. May train patient in the use of prosthetic and/or orthotic
  6. Maintains appropriate clinical records, clinical notes, and reports to the physician any changes in the patient’s condition. Submits these records in accordance with Organization policy.
  7. Maintains contact/communication with other personnel involved in the patient’s care to promote coordinated, efficient care.
  8. Attends and contributes to in-services, case conferences, and other meetings as required by Organization policy to ensure coordinated and comprehensive plans of care for the patients of the Organization.
  9. Identifies patient and family/caregiver needs for other home health services and refers as
  10. Instructs patient’s family/caregiver and other Organization health care personnel in patient’s treatment regime when indicated and appropriate.
  11. Supervises certified occupational therapy assistants according to organization policy and state

When therapy is the only skilled service, instructs, supervises and evaluates home health aide care every two (2) weeks
